platform/x86/amd/hsmp: Source metric-table size from firmware
The driver hard-codes the metric-table region size to
sizeof(struct hsmp_metric_table). That is correct for HSMP protocol
version 6 but mis-sizes the ioremap of the SMU DRAM region on newer
platforms: Family 1Ah Model 50h-5Fh exposes a ~13 KB table under
protocol version 7, and the table is expected to keep growing on
future firmware. The same hard-coded value also forces
hsmp_metric_tbl_read() to reject any read that follows the actual
firmware layout.
Pick up the table size from firmware instead. SMU on Family 1Ah
Model 50h and later populates HSMP_GET_METRIC_TABLE_DRAM_ADDR's
args[2] with the DRAM region size in bytes; older firmware leaves it
0. Bump the descriptor's response_sz to 3 so the field is read, and
store the result in the new per-socket hsmp_socket.metric_tbl_size,
which is then used both for the ioremap() of the region and as the
expected size in hsmp_metric_tbl_read().
The size is stored per socket rather than per platform because
hsmp_get_tbl_dram_base() runs once per socket and each socket maps
its own region. A single platform-wide field would let the last
socket's size be used to copy out of an earlier socket's smaller
mapping.
Bump DRIVER_VERSION to 2.6.
Behaviour on existing protocol-version-6 hardware is unchanged.
Reading a third response word is safe there: for this command SMU
leaves args[2] as 0 rather than a stale value from an earlier
mailbox transaction, so the fallback always applies, yielding the
same value as the previous hard-coded one, and both the ioremap and
the size check produce the same result as before.
